I understand you are facing an issue with the printer settings or the driver configuration. 

 

Here are a few steps you can try to troubleshoot the problem:

 

  • Check Printer Settings: Make sure the printer settings are configured correctly. Open the printer properties on your computer and ensure that the paper size and other settings match the settings of the paper you are using.
  • Update Printer Drivers: Ensure that you have the latest drivers installed for your HP DeskJet 2724 All-in-One Printerprinter. You can download the latest drivers from the HP website or use the device manager to check for updates. HP DeskJet 2724 All-in-One Printer Software and Driver
  • Paper Size Settings: Double-check the paper size settings in both the printer properties on your computer and on the printer itself. Ensure they match the size of the paper you are using.
  • Print Preview: Before printing, use the print preview option to see how the document will appear on the paper. This can help identify any scaling issues or other abnormalities.
  • Reset Printer: Try resetting the printer to its default settings. Refer to the printer's user manual for instructions on how to do this.
  • Paper Tray Adjustment: If your printer has adjustable paper trays, make sure they are set to accommodate the size of the paper you are using.
  • Printer Firmware Update: Check if there are any firmware updates available for your printer and install them if necessary. Firmware updates can sometimes resolve printing issues. Update the firmware on an HP printer
  • Test Print: Print a test page to see if the issue persists. This can help determine if the problem is specific to certain documents or if it affects all printing.
